Joe and Linda Chlapaty have been the biggest Spartan supporters for sure but the University of Dubuque's "revival" was anything but a "one man" show. Let's not forget the generousity of the Wendt family ($30+ Million) and Charles & Romona Myers ($30+ Million).

I hope , I mean think all of them are doing it to stick it to Lorass  ;)

In reality, Loras has nothing to do with it. Regardless of how fortunate the University of Dubuque has been in the past 13 years since the transformation, UD has had a strong 160 year tradition of educating students and the investments will help secure that for many years to come. I've been awfully quiet on the postboard for much of the season. I don't believe in giving constant individual "props" to players.

But, in case anyone hasn't been following closely and if my math is correct, Michael Zweifel currently has 425 Receptions, 5581 Yards, and 50 TD's in his college career. The All-Time NCAA (All Divisions- D-I; D-IAA; D-II; D-III) Reception Record stands at 436.

I am sure Luther and Coe will do everything they can to stop him from achieving history but something tells me it's not a matter of "if" but "when".
